引言在软件开发过程中,数据库是存储和检索数据的核心。C作为一种广泛使用的编程语言,提供了丰富的数据库操作功能。本文将深入探讨C数据库连接的实现方法,以及如何通过这些连接实现高效的数据交互与处理。一、C...
在软件开发过程中,数据库是存储和检索数据的核心。C#作为一种广泛使用的编程语言,提供了丰富的数据库操作功能。本文将深入探讨C#数据库连接的实现方法,以及如何通过这些连接实现高效的数据交互与处理。
C#数据库连接主要依赖于ADO.NET(ActiveX Data Objects .NET)框架。ADO.NET提供了一套丰富的类,用于与数据库进行交互。以下是C#数据库连接的基本步骤:
以下是一个简单的C#数据库连接示例,演示如何连接到SQL Server数据库,并执行一个查询操作:
using System;
using System.Data.SqlClient;
class Program
{ static void Main() { // 创建连接字符串 string connectionString = "Data Source=your_server;Initial Catalog=your_database;Integrated Security=True"; // 创建连接对象 using (SqlConnection connection = new SqlConnection(connectionString)) { try { // 打开连接 connection.Open(); // 创建命令对象 using (SqlCommand command = new SqlCommand("SELECT * FROM YourTable", connection)) { // 执行查询 using (SqlDataReader reader = command.ExecuteReader()) { while (reader.Read()) { // 读取数据 Console.WriteLine(reader["YourColumn"].ToString()); } } } } catch (Exception ex) { Console.WriteLine("Error: " + ex.Message); } } }
}为了提高C#数据库连接的效率,以下是一些优化建议:
C#数据库连接是实现高效数据交互与处理的关键。通过本文的介绍,相信您已经对C#数据库连接有了更深入的了解。在实际开发过程中,请根据具体需求选择合适的数据库连接方法,并注意优化以提高性能。